A search is underway for an Albemarle teen's remains as police believe she is dead.

The Albemarle Police Department said officers responded to a home along Floral Drive at 4:30 a.m. Friday after getting a 9-1-1 call from someone asking for help. The department and the North Carolina State Bureau of Investigation said their inquiry led them to determine that 17-year-old Baylee Carver had died.

According to court documents, investigators believe Biles moved Carver's body from a Floral Drive home and hid it. They also say Carver's body had "obvious wounds indicating an unnatural death." As the search for the victim's remains continues, investigators have not explained how they knew her body had wounds. Charlotte city workers rallied outside Monday's City Council meeting, demanding officials make raising their salaries a priority. The workers say their current paychecks aren't keeping up with the cost of living and they don't feel appreciated despite providing essential services for the city of Charlotte.
